Keynote Speech
4jpg.jpg
Semuel Leunufna, MSc. PhD.
Pattimura University Ambon Indonesia
Center for the Conservation of Maluku Biodiversity
Topics:Protocol Development and Genetic Consistency of Cryopreservation Derived Materials of Yams (Dioscorea spp.)
Brief Introduction of the Speaker
Semuel Leunufna MSc., PhD is an Associate Professor at the Pattimura University Ambon Maluku, Indonesia, lecturing on Biodiversity and Conservation, Plant Genetics and Plant Breeding courses.He is also the director of the “Center for the Conservation of Maluku’s Biodiversity”.During his early career he was appointed as a research staff member of the project “Crop Potentials of Underexploited Tuberous Yams and Aroids”, a joint project between United States Agency for International Development (USAID) and the Pattimura University Ambon, doing survays and taxonomic studies on Yams (Dioscorea spp.). During 1988-1989 he worked as an adjunct lecturer at the Bogor Agricultural Institute (IPB), Bogor, lecturing on Mendelian Genetics and researching on the Cytogenetics of Chili peppers. Dr. Leunufna received his MSc degree from the Department of Crop Science (Ontario Agriculture College-OAC), University of Guelph, Guelph Ontario, Canada in Plant Breeding under the scholarship of Canadian International Development Agency (CIDA). Before completing his PhD. degree under the scholarship of German Academic Exchange Service (DAAD) he attanded an eleven months advanced training program on “The Utilization of Plant Genetic Resources as a Contribution to Food Security” in Germany funded by Deutsche Stifftung fuer Internationale Entwicklung (DSE). His Doctorate research on, in vitro maintenance and cryopreservation of yams (Dioscorea spp.), was completed at the Institute for Plant Genetics and Crop Plant Research (IPK) Gatersleben, Germany and was promoted at the Martin Luther Universitaet Halle-Wittenberg, Halle-Saale, Germany. After completing one year position as a research staff member at the IPK Gatersleben, he returned to the Pattimura University, Indonesia. A great number of publications have been accomplished by Dr. Leunufna either in the journals, proceedings of conferences, magazines and news papers.
